The 3 months correlation between Farmmi and Seaboard is -0.53.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Farmmi Inc and Seaboard in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Seaboard and Farmmi is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Farmmi Inc are associated (or correlated) with Seaboard.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Seaboard has no effect on the direction of Farmmi i.e., Farmmi and Seaboard go up and down completely randomly.

Given the investment horizon of 90 days Farmmi Inc is expected to under-perform the Seaboard. In addition to that, Farmmi is 2.13 times more volatile than Seaboard. It trades about -0.2 of its total potential returns per unit of risk. Seaboard is currently generating about 0.1 per unit of volatility. If you would invest 238,911 in Seaboard on December 29, 2024 and sell it today you would earn a total of 32,218 from holding Seaboard or generate 13.49% return on investment over 90 days.

Pair Trading with Farmmi and Seaboard
The main advantage of trading using opposite Farmmi and Seaboard posit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Farmmi position performs unexpectedly, Seaboard can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
